We've been watching chatbots closely. Because what may seem like magic is actually clever technology. Most companies communicate via social media by now. And while using chatbots in social media is still somewhat unusual, that in itself is no reason for applause. For the perfect illusion to work, the chatbot needs to surprise your customers with helpful answers to their questions.

Technical documentation already contains many of these answers. But how do you reuse the answers in your documentation to feed your chatbot? The key to this not-so-magic trick: transform the technical documentation into intelligent information. We invite you to watch closely as well.
